Volleyball Recap: Rushville-Industry Rockets vs. Astoria/VIT Rebels
It can be hard to translate regular season success to the playoffs, but Rushville-Industry had no problem doing just that on Tuesday. They came out on top against the Astoria/VIT Rebels by a score of 2-0. That's more bragging rights for the Rockets,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.
Rushville-Industry easily took the second set, but they let things get interesting in the other. The final score came out to 25-21, 25-11.
Rushville-Industry's win was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Kaylee Shaw, who had six digs and three aces. Shaw has been hot recently, having posted three or more aces the last three times she's played.
Rushville-Industry has been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four contests, which provided a nice bump to their 18-15 record this season. As for Astoria/VIT, they are on a five-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-26.
Rushville-Industry will take on Triopia at 7: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Rushville-Industry is no doubt hoping to put an end to a six-game streak of away losses. Astoria/VIT does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
